Rare pair of armchairs by Mario Oreglia 1949
Description:
Pair of armchairs designed by Mario Oreglia.
Rare armchairs with a geometric design.
Large and enveloping, the designer reinterprets the classic bergere armchair in a modern key.
Wide comfortable seat and large angular wings.
Upholstered in fine blue velvet.
Produced in 1949.
Designed by Mario Oreglia, a Turin architect.
Published in Domus magazine n237 page 52 of 1949.
MEASUREMENTS:
Height 116 cm, seat height 43 cm.
Width 77 cm;
Depth 85 cm
